    Spaghetti with Marinara Sauce

    servings 4
    points 5

    List of Ingredients




    3/4 cup chopped onion
    3 cloves garlic, finely chopped
    2 cups water
    1 can (16 ounces) no-salt-added tomato sauce
    1 can (6 ounces) tomato paste
    2 bay leaves
    1 teaspoon dried oregano leaves
    1 teaspoon dried basil leaves
    1/2 teaspoon dried marjoram leaves
    1/2 teaspoon honey
    1/4 teaspoon black pepper
    8 ounces uncooked spaghetti, cooked, drained and kept hot

    Recipe



    Heat oil in large saucepan. Add onion and garlic. Cook and stir 5 minutes or until onion is tender. Add water, tomato sauce, tomato paste, bay leaves, oregano, basil, marjoram, honey and pepper. Bring to a boil, stirring occasionally. Reduce heat; simmer 1 hour, stirring occasionally.

    Remove and discard bay leaves. Measure 2 cups sauce; reserve remaining sauce for another use. Serve sauce over cooked pasta.



    Nutrients per Serving
    (1 cup cooked Spaghetti with 1/4 of remaining Marinara Sauce)
    Calories 289
    Calories from Fat
    Total Fat 2 g
    Saturated Fat
    Carbohydrate 58 g
    Fiber 3 g
    Protein 10 g
    Sodium 213 mg
